Penryn train station, while modest, offers key facilities to ensure a smooth journey. Though it lacks a ticket office, there are ticket machines available for purchasing and collecting your travel tickets. Accessibility is a top priority - the station offers step-free access throughout, making it easy for passengers with mobility needs. Customer help points are present, complemented by departure screens, announcements, and assistance for passengers requiring help. If you are planning a trip, assistance can be requested up to two hours before your journey starts through the Passenger Assist service. However, bear in mind that there are no refreshment facilities, ATM, or waiting rooms at the station.

Watford Junction is designed with the traveler in mind, offering a host of facilities to ensure a seamless journey. The ticket office is operational from 5:30 AM to 11:00 PM every day except Sunday when it opens at 6:30 AM—ideal for early risers and night owls alike. If you've purchased tickets online, you can conveniently collect them at the ticket machines located in the booking hall. For those requiring assistance, an induction loop is available, enhancing accessibility for travelers with hearing aids.
Step-free access throughout the station ensures it is user-friendly for all, including individuals with reduced mobility. Accessible toilets operated with a RADAR key are available, and assistance can be booked in advance for anyone needing extra help. For those using wheeled transport, ramps are available for train access, and there's a dedicated area with 19 accessible parking spaces in the car park.
As you await your train, enjoy a variety of refreshment facilities available on-site. Grab a quick bite or a cup of coffee from one of the shops, and find an ATM machine for any last-minute cash needs. Although there is no public Wi-Fi, the fully stocked amenities ensure a comfortable wait. Unfortunately, there is no waiting room service, but seating areas are available.
